Christianus, a Latin name, means "Christian, follower of Christ." The term "Christ" originates from the Ancient Greek word "khrīstós," meaning "Messiah or Christ." This title refers to Jesus of Nazareth, and its Hebrew translation, "Māšîaḥ," also means "anointed." Notably, the name Christian gained popularity as a female first name in Scotland during the 17th and 18th centuries.
